■ Accessフォーム
フォームを開く
DoCmd.OpenForm "F_一覧"
ダイアログ形式でフォームを開く
DoCmd.OpenForm "F_一覧", , , , , acDialog
フォームの最大化
DoCmd.Maximize
フォームの最小化
DoCmd.Minimize
フォームを元のサイズに戻す
DoCmd.Restore
フォームのタイトル
F_一覧.Caption = "情報一覧"
フォームを閉じる
DoCmd.Close
フォームを指定して閉じる
DoCmd.Close acForm, "F_一覧"
■ Accessレポート
印刷
DoCmd.OpenReport "R_一覧", acNormal
印刷プレビュー
DoCmd.OpenReport "R_一覧", acPreview
■ Accessコントロール
コントロールにフォーカスを移す
Commandbutton1.SetFocus
コントロールを非表示
Commandbutton1.Visible = False
コントロールを表示
Commandbutton1.Visible = False
コントロールのヒントを設定
Commandbutton1.ControlTipText = "クリックしてください。"
コントロール使用不可にする
Commandbutton1.Enabled = False
テキストボックス・コンボボックスを編集不可にする
TextBox1.Locked = True
背景色を変更
TextBox1.BackColor = VbRed
文字色を変更
TextBox1.ForeColor = VbBlack
■ Accessツールバー
ツールバーを表示
DoCmd.ShowToolbar "MyToolbar", acToolbarYes
ツールバーを非表示
DoCmd.ShowToolbar "MyToolbar", acToolbarNo
■ Accessオプション設定の操作
レコードの変更時に確認メッセージを表示しない
Application.SetOption "Confirm Record Changes", False
レコードの変更時に確認メッセージを表示する
Application.SetOption "Confirm Record Changes", False
オブジェクトを削除する時警告メッセージを表示しない
Application.SetOption "Confirm Document Deletions", False
オブジェクトを削除する時警告メッセージを表示する
Application.SetOption "Confirm Document Deletions", True
アクションクエリを実行する前にメッセージを表示しない
Application.SetOption "Confirm Action Queries", False
アクションクエリを実行する前にメッセージを表示する
Application.SetOption "Confirm Action Queries", True
新規作成されるレポート・フォームの余白の設定
Application.SetOption "Left Margin", 1
Application.SetOption "Right Margin", 0.8
Application.SetOption "Top Margin", 1.5
Application.SetOption "Bottom Margin", 1.2
閉じるとき最適化を行う
Application.SetOption "Auto Compact", True
閉じるとき最適化をしない
Application.SetOption "Auto Compact", False
■ Accessレコード操作
先頭レコードの取得
s = DFirst("名前", "T_基本")
検索
s = DLookup("名前", "T_基本", "ID =50")
テーブルの削除
DoCmd.DeleteObject acTable, "T_基本情報"
■Access
自分自身のファイルが存在するフォルダ+ファイル名
Application.CurrentDb.Name
自分自身のファイルが存在するフォルダ
Application.CurrentProject.Path
Accessを終了
Application.Quit